HCL Technologies announced an interim dividend of ₹12 per share and the completion of its ₹2,275 crore acquisition of Jaspersoft. The company also reported strong Q1 FY27 results with profit up 20.3%.
HCL Technologies Announces ₹12 Dividend and Completes Jaspersoft Acquisition
Q1 FY27 Profit: ₹4,626 crore | Revenue: ₹34,579 crore

What just happened
HCL Technologies has declared an interim dividend of ₹12 per equity share for the financial year 2026-27. The record date for this dividend is July 17, 2026, with payments scheduled for July 27, 2026. Additionally, the company announced the successful completion of its acquisition of Jaspersoft, a business unit of Cloud Software Group, for ₹2,275 crore on July 1, 2026.

Context metrics (time-bound)
For Q1 FY27, HCL Technologies reported revenue from operations of ₹34,579 crore, a significant increase from ₹30,349 crore in Q1 FY26. Profit for the period grew by 20.3% to ₹4,626 crore from ₹3,844 crore in the same period last year. Basic EPS rose to ₹17.09 from ₹14.18.
